In order to allow customers to make use of connlib's DoH functionality, we need a configuration UI for it. We take inspiration from the "New Resource" page and implement a 3-choice UI component for configuring how Clients should resolve DNS queries: - System - Secure DNS - Custom The secure and custom DNS options show an additional form when selected for either picking a DoH provider or the addresses of the custom DNS servers. Right now, the "Secure DNS" part is disabled if the `DISABLE_DOH_PROVIDER` env variable is set. We render a "Coming soon" tooltip on hover: <img width="1534" height="1100" alt="image" src="https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/a12a6ba4-806f-4d19-8aea-5c1cd981d609" /> This allows us to test this in staging and still ship to production if needed prior to enabling it. To start your Phoenix server:
- Run
mix setupto install and setup dependencies - Start Phoenix endpoint with
mix phx.serveror inside IEx withiex -S mix phx.server
Now you can visit localhost:4000 from your browser.
